Near the Royal Forest of Dean and just a few minutes’ drive from Tintern Abbey, this beautifully appointed and warm lodge with its own hot tub commands wonderful views over the sylvan Wye Valley above Brockweir. Easily accessed year round, this border territory is marked by stunning scenery and brooding castles. There are delightful market towns to explore and the walking is excellent, whether on Offa’s Dyke, in the forest or along the river bank. Chepstow’s castle, racecourse and golf courses about 5 miles. Shop and pub/restaurant 1 mile.
